Alia's Carnival! Sacrament Plus is a visual novel set in a Japanese school where students run their own affairs. You play as Ren, a transfer student reuniting with his sister and childhood friend while navigating a self-governed academy. After saving a mysterious girl named Asuha, he's pulled into her club's mission to unlock "ALIA" and reshape the school. Choices influence relationships and outcomes as you balance class duties, club activities, and personal connections. The story weaves school life with supernatural hints and romantic subplots across branching paths. This PS4 version adds content from the PC expansion Flowering Sky to the original 2015 PS Vita release. With over 20 hours of gameplay and multiple endings, fans praise its character dynamics and slow-burn narrative. A 7.8/10 on VNDB reflects its solid but niche appeal. Available in English, it leans into slice-of-life charm with occasional mystery, best suited for visual novel players who enjoy school-based stories with light drama. Released in 2019, it runs smoothly on PlayStation 4 with no major updates since launch.
The Sakumo ward is well known for its cherry blossoms. In recent years, as part of the redevelopment of the ward, an experimental education system was introduced where the students would govern themselves in the newly constructed Sakumodai Gakuin to improve the student life. Those students who are capable and work hard to improve the learning environment would receive various benefits. Also, it seemed that the one with the top results would get a special privilege. Ren returned to Sakumo ward after a long time away and transferred into the school, reuniting with his timid little sister Karin and childhood friend Shiina, who had grown up to be very beautiful. On his first day at school, he was caught up in some trouble and ended up saving a girl. The girl Asuha asked him to join her club, aim for ALIA and change the school. He was puzzled over her sudden invitation but was excited that his new school life will surely be an exciting one
